The Story of Tylin

Tylin is a modern American name that blends the popular Ty- prefix (from Tyler, of Old French tieulier meaning tile maker) with the -lin/-len suffix common in contemporary names like Jaylen, Kylen, and Rylan. Tyler emerged in the 1980s as a popular surname-turned-given-name, and the -lin variant represents a new generation's approach to personalizing the sound while keeping the familiar Ty- start.

Tylin appeared in the 2000s and 2010s as part of the broader trend of -lin/-len suffix names for boys. It appeals to parents who like the strong Ty- beginning but want something less common than Tyler or Tyson.

Tylin represents the American tradition of surname-derived given names and the creative hybridization of name elements. The Ty- prefix carries a strong, confident masculine energy in American naming culture.

Fun Facts

  • Tyler entered the top 10 baby names in the US in 1992 and remained there for years, spawning creative variants like Tylin
  • The -lin suffix in American names is influenced by both Welsh (-lyn) and African-American naming traditions
